Caramelo[Japanese title] is a character in Kirby's Dream Land 3. It is an egg-shaped creature with a face on its upper white part and a yellow bottom part. It appears in the third stage of Sand Canyon and will give Kirby a Heart Star at the end of the stage if he succeeds in the How many of the same face are there? Sub-Game earlier in the stage. Due to running a minigame, it also reappears in MG-5.
